溫馨提示×

centos中sqlserver數據如何備份

小樊
64
2025-05-27 10:26:19
欄目: 云計算

在CentOS系統中備份SQL Server數據,可以按照以下步驟進行:

方法一:使用SQL Server Management Studio (SSMS)

  1. 安裝SSMS
  • 如果尚未安裝,可以從Microsoft官方網站下載并安裝SQL Server Management Studio。
  1. 連接到SQL Server實例
  • 打開SSMS并連接到目標SQL Server實例。
  1. 備份數據庫
  • 在對象資源管理器中,展開“數據庫”節點。
  • 右鍵點擊要備份的數據庫,選擇“任務” > “備份…”。
  • 在彈出的“備份數據庫”窗口中,配置備份類型(完整、差異或日志)。
  • 選擇備份目標(通常是磁盤文件)。
  • 點擊“確定”開始備份過程。
  1. 監控備份進度
  • 備份過程中,可以在SSMS中查看進度條和相關日志信息。

方法二:使用T-SQL命令

  1. 登錄到SQL Server
  • 使用sqlcmd或其他SQL客戶端工具登錄到目標數據庫實例。
  1. 執行備份命令
  • 運行以下T-SQL命令來創建數據庫備份:
BACKUP DATABASE [YourDatabaseName]
TO DISK = N'/path/to/backup/file.bak'
WITH NOFORMAT, NOINIT, NAME = N'YourDatabaseName-Full Database Backup', SKIP, NOREWIND, NOUNLOAD, STATS = 10;
  • 替換YourDatabaseName為你要備份的數據庫名稱,/path/to/backup/file.bak為備份文件的存儲路徑。
  1. 檢查備份狀態
  • 備份完成后,可以運行以下命令來查看備份日志:
RESTORE HEADERONLY FROM DISK = N'/path/to/backup/file.bak';

方法三:使用SQL Server Agent作業

如果你希望定期自動執行備份任務,可以使用SQL Server Agent作業:

  1. 創建備份作業
  • 在SSMS中,展開“SQL Server代理”節點,右鍵點擊“作業”,選擇“新建作業…”。
  • 在“常規”頁簽中,輸入作業名稱和描述。
  • 在“步驟”頁簽中,添加一個新的步驟,選擇“Transact-SQL腳本(T-SQL)”作為類型,并輸入備份命令。
  • 在“計劃”頁簽中,配置作業的執行頻率和時間。
  1. 保存并啟用作業
  • 點擊“確定”保存作業設置,并確保作業處于啟用狀態。

注意事項

  • 確保備份文件存儲在安全的位置,并定期檢查其完整性。
  • 根據需要調整備份策略,例如備份頻率、保留期限等。
  • 在生產環境中執行備份操作時,請務必謹慎,并在非高峰時段進行。

通過以上方法,你可以在CentOS系統中有效地備份SQL Server數據。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女